How Much Is 299 Cups of Pearl Barley in Pounds?

299 cups of pearl barley weighs 131.84 lb. This is based on pearl barley having a density of 200g per cup. Because cups measure volume and pounds measure weight, the result depends on the ingredient, and a different ingredient would give a different result for the same 299 cups.

Formula and Step-by-Step

cups × 200g/cup ÷ 453.592g/lb = pounds
  1. Start with 299 cups of pearl barley
  2. 1 cup of pearl barley = 200g
  3. 299 × 200 = 59,800g
  4. Convert grams to pounds: 59,800 ÷ 453.592 = 131.84 lb

The same formula works for any amount. Multiply (or divide) by the density, then convert units as needed.

Understanding the Units

What is a Cup?

In US cooking, a cup measures volume, not weight. One standard US cup holds 236.588 ml of liquid. Because different ingredients have different densities, a cup of one ingredient can weigh very differently from a cup of another.

What is a Pound?

A pound (lb) is a US customary unit of weight equal to 453.592 grams or 16 ounces. It is used for larger quantities of ingredients like flour, sugar, and meat.

For the most accurate results, weigh pearl barley on a kitchen scale. If measuring by volume, spoon the ingredient into the measuring cup and level it off with a straight edge rather than scooping directly.
Weight-per-cup values vary because of differences in how the ingredient is measured (spooned vs scooped), grind size, moisture content, and settling during storage. Our values use standardized measurement methods from established culinary references.
